 62GA c  2021Or01: {+62}Ge isotope produced in {+9}Be({+78}Kr,X),E({+78}Kr)=345
 62GA2c  MeV/nucleon reaction at the RIBF-RIKEN facility. Fragments were
 62GA3c  separated, selected and identified in mass and charge by the BigRIPS
 62GA4c  separator according to B|r-|DE-tof, and transported and implanted into
 62GA5c  the WAS3ABi array consisting of three double-sided silicon-strip
 62GA6c  detectors (DSSSDs) at the exit of the ZeroDegree spectrometer. The |g
 62GA7c  rays were detected using the EURICA array of HPGe detectors. Measured
 62GA8c  E|g, I|g, implant-decay time correlations. Deduced parent levels, J|p,
 62GA9c  and Gamow-Teller strengths. See also 2023OrZZ.

 62GA c  2014Gr10: study of Gamow-Teller decay of T=1, J|p=0+ {+62}Ge g.s. to
 62GA2c  N=Z {+62}Ga nucleus. The {+62}Ge source was formed in fragmentation of
 62GA3c  750 MeV/nucleon {+78}Kr beam impinging a {+9}Be target, followed by
 62GA4c  B|r-|DE-B|r and time-of-flight analysis by using FRS fragment separator
 62GA5c  and various scintillation and ionization detectors at GSI facility. The
 62GA6c  ions of {+62}Ga were implanted into a pack of six 1 mm thick
 62GA7c  double-sided silicon strip detectors (DSSSDs). Measured E|g, I|g,
 62GA8c  (particle)|g-coin, (fragment)|b- and |b|g-coin, half-life of {+62}Ge
 62GA9c  ground state. Deduced levels, J|p, |e feedings, log {Ift} values,
 62GAAc  B(GT) strengths. Comparison with shell model and QRPA calculations.

 62GA cE $Value of log| {Ift}=3.525 {I34} probably suggests this |b transition
 62GA2cE to be superallowed as it overlaps unweighted averaged log| {Ift}
 62GA3cE of 3.485 {I1}, deduced from 15 precise (uncertainties of |<6.9)
 62GA4cE {Ift} values of superallowed |b transitions listed in Table XVI
 62GA5cE of 2020Ha30 evaluation. If Q(|e)=9730 {I140}, as suggested by 2021Or01
 62GA6cE is used, then log| {Ift}=3.49 {I4}.
